

Way out of their rural Ohio depth — and gloriously so — The Astro-Phonics were three science-club misfits who bonded over surf records and issues of _Popular Mechanics_. In 1965 they dragged a homemade echo tank (constructed from a washtub, spare springs, and a borrowed church microphone) into a friend’s barn and cut “Pulsar Boogie,” a reverb-drenched instrumental so bizarre for its time that local DJs refused to play it, insisting it was “either broken or communist.”
